Block 638,331
Block Hash
ce8a84494ea1c6d4ea596dff9b3cbe1b6c402dbf6539c5530e70f94d450163e1
Previous Block Hash
ac91816195dffe04cd559de027494bc29fc24b229e0a08bbb961a1f52ca5f873
Mined
Transactions
3
Difficulty
21.34 M
Size
622 bytes
Transactions (3)
1 input, 1 output
10,000.00452
PEPE
1 input, 2 outputs
87,334.43812
PEPE
1 input, 2 outputs
87,333.43586
PEPE